Dear Colleagues,

The Camille and Henry Dreyfus Foundation is pleased to announce awards for
programs and the 2013 Dreyfus Prize topic. Please follow the links below
for additional information:

2012 Special Grant Program in the Chemical Sciences

http://dreyfus.org/announcements/CURR-SpecialGrant.pdf

2013 Dreyfus Prize in the Chemical Sciences
http://dreyfus.org/awards/prize.shtml
